GAMIT版北斗数据处理详解:流程、配置与注意事项
5星 · 超过95%的资源 需积分: 50 25 浏览量
更新于2024-07-18
5
收藏 10.57MB PPTX 举报
北斗数据处理流程——利用GAMIT进行精密导航
在现代信息技术领域,北斗系统作为全球卫星导航系统的一员,其数据处理对于精确定位、导航和地球科学研究至关重要。GAMIT(Global Analysis and Modeling Intercomparison Study)是一款广泛使用的软件,用于处理全球范围内的多卫星导航数据,包括北斗系统。本文将详细介绍基于GAMIT 10.61版本的北斗数据处理流程,以及相关的设置和注意事项。
首先,数据获取阶段,从武汉大学IGS(International GNSS Service)数据中心获取数据,如混合多系统广播星历文件brdm3050.17p,该文件包含了北斗系统的广播星历信息;同时,精密星历文件whs19733.sp3也必不可少,它提供了更高精度的卫星轨道信息。通过FTP链接下载这些数据,并确保所有必要的rinex(Receiver Independent Exchange Format)文件如*3050.17o和tables文件都已准备就绪。
处理流程的第一步是建立数据处理环境,通过命令行工具链接所需的文件,如$sh_setup-yr2017-doy305,该命令会创建指向brdc目录下广播星历文件、igs目录下的精密星历、rinex目录下的观测数据和tables目录下所有支持文件的符号链接。检查链接是否有效,避免红色无效链接的存在。
接着,进入参数配置阶段,GAMIT允许用户选择海潮改正模型,例如设置Useotl.list和Useotl.grid,这有助于减少海洋潮汐对定位结果的影响。此外,用户还可以设置采样间隔(setsint)、处理的时段长度(setnepc)以及处理的开始时间(setstime),这些参数的选择通常根据具体研究需求来决定。
在坐标计算部分,GAMIT的$sh_rx2apr工具被用来执行单点定位计算。通过输入站点数据文件sitedacn3050.17o,广播星历文件brdm3050.17p,参考星历文件refxncn3050.17o,以及使用tables目录中的ITRF08.apr作为转换参数,进行精密的坐标计算。这个过程涉及到测量误差的校正,确保位置数据的准确性。
最后,处理流程还包括定期更新测站信息文件($sh_upd_stnfo–files../rinex/*o),以保持最新的定位参数,确保整个分析的时效性。
北斗数据处理流程利用GAMIT涉及多个步骤,从数据获取、环境配置到坐标计算,每个环节都需要仔细处理和调整,以达到最优的定位精度和结果质量。了解并掌握这一流程对于从事北斗相关应用的科研人员和工程师来说,是非常重要的。
2020-02-24 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
2020-07-03 上传
简单才最傻
- 粉丝: 1
- 资源: 7
最新资源
- Android圆角进度条控件的设计与应用
- mui框架实现带侧边栏的响应式布局
- Android仿知乎横线直线进度条实现教程
- SSM选课系统实现:Spring+SpringMVC+MyBatis源码剖析
- 使用JavaScript开发的流星待办事项应用
- Google Code Jam 2015竞赛回顾与Java编程实践
- Angular 2与NW.js集成:通过Webpack和Gulp构建环境详解
- OneDayTripPlanner:数字化城市旅游活动规划助手
- TinySTM 轻量级原子操作库的详细介绍与安装指南
- 模拟PHP序列化:JavaScript实现序列化与反序列化技术
- ***进销存系统全面功能介绍与开发指南
- 掌握Clojure命名空间的正确重新加载技巧
- 免费获取VMD模态分解Matlab源代码与案例数据
- BuglyEasyToUnity最新更新优化:简化Unity开发者接入流程
- Android学生俱乐部项目任务2解析与实践
- 掌握Elixir语言构建高效分布式网络爬虫